Output fa0fa0808028fb87c95496ea1785562d5de67725d34bc134e3967a2a1fc255e9:24

value
566266005
script pubkey
OP_0 OP_PUSHBYTES_20 8e8bb44cab96e2cb66bc11c52c488666a7ca5e4b
address
bc1q369mgn9tjm3vke4uz8zjcjyxv6nu5hjtekf2ht
transaction
fa0fa0808028fb87c95496ea1785562d5de67725d34bc134e3967a2a1fc255e9
spent
true